What affects the price

Fireplace pricing depends on your specific setup. If you already have a gas line or a chimney in place, the work is much simpler and cheaper. Installing from scratch requires more labor, including framing, venting, and finishing work with stone or tile. The type of unit—whether it is gas, wood, or electric—also changes the budget significantly. Larger units or custom hearth designs naturally add to the cost compared to basic inserts. What is the 2 + 10 rule for fireplaces?

The 2+10 rule is a safety guideline for chimneys, stating they must be at least two feet taller than any part of the building within a ten-foot radius. This ensures proper draft and prevents smoke from entering the home. Professionals will ensure your Chandler installation meets this and all other safety codes.
